The California Chapter has always provided financial assistance to members to get out and explore Recreational Therapy opportunities. Whether helping members to attend one of the VA’s annual programs such as the National Veteran’s Wheelchair Games (NVWG) or the National Disabled Veteran’s Winter Sports Clinic (NDVWSC) etc, or something more in tune with an individuals passion such as a Table Tennis Tournament in Texas or SCUBA diving in the Florida Keys. We also provided for recreational activities such as tickets for professional sports, concert, and movies or theater as well.
The Chapter has been doing this for years. Unfortunately, many members were not aware of this form of financial assistance.

Maybe you want to go see a play, or a movie, or a sports game and see how accessible the venue is. Let us know and you can use your grant to do that as well.
Simply put, as a chapter member, you are eligible for up to $2000/year in possible recreational grants. All we ask is that you fill out a simple form in advance and submit it 45 days in advance, and submit your receipts within 30 days of attending the event.
